Winter League
The weather has already caused some changes to the dates for the Winter Cup Qualifying Round dates even though the competition hasn't started yet. Over the last 6 days we have lost a total of 8 days of League fixtures. Three of the 8 days have been rearranged so far, they being:
Division 3 (Springwood)
Postponed on Wednesday 7 January will now be played on Wednesday 4 February.
Division 7 (Huddersfield RUFC)
Postponed on Thursday 8 January will now be played on Tuesday 13 January
Division 10 (Netherton Con)
Postponed on Monday 5 January will now be played on Tuesday 3 February
Bowlsnet has been updated to show these changes
The other five host clubs are waiting for the end of the cold spell and the threat to more fixture losses over the coming week before finalising new dates for the lost fixtures.
The rearranging of League fixtures can impact the published dates of Winter Cup dates. Where the lost fixtures have been added on to the League season and so replace a Winter Cup Qualifying Round (as is the case with the Division 3 rearranged fixtures), then the Winter Cup date drops back a further week. So the Division 3 (Springwood) Winter Cup Qualifying Round will now be played 7 days later than originally advertised, and will now be played on Wednesday 11 February. Any bowler that has entered the Winter Cup but is not available on any new date will be able to claim a refund of their entry fee.
As new dates for the lost fixtures are finalised they will be updated on Bowlsnet. The League has always treated the Bowlsnet information as the Bible for fixtures in the Winter League and the first port of call for any club/bowler wanting to know the latest state of play with fixtures.
